Fade not working with schedule

I'm having issues setting my scheduled events to fade on rather than turn on instantly, the steps to reproduce the issue are:
- Go to device
- Go to schedule
- Set an event to 'Fade On' the bulb at a certain time
- Save and go back
- Go back into the scheduled event, bulb will be set to 'Turn On', i.e. instant on, rather than 'Fade On'
If I go in and change it back to 'Fade On', and then save and go back, it will revert to 'Turn On' every time.

@Wayne-TP yes I've tested by setting it and watching it, it's definitely switching it to instant on instead of fade on, i've narrowed it down to only happening when the light preset it set to 'Auto Match', if I set it to a fixed colour it retains the fade setting.
